Which expression is equivalent to 14x − 7 + 3(2x − 5)?

Mathematics
1 answer:
g100num [7]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

This equation is equivalent to 20x-22

\mathrm{Expand}\:3\left(2x-5\right):\quad 6x-15\\=14x-7+6x-15\\\mathrm{Simplify}\:14x-7+6x-15:\quad 20x-22\\=20x-22

9.35 as a fraction in simpliest form
Lana71 [14]
We know that
the number 9.35
is equal to 
9+0.35
and
0.35  is equal to
35/100
divide by 5 both members
\frac{35}{100} = \frac{7}{20}

therefore

the number 9.35  is equal to  9  \frac{7}{20}

Paul wants a bike that cost $400. If he had saved 60% of this amount, how much had he saved.
enyata [817]
Hey!


To solve this problem, we'll first start by creating an equation.

<em>Our Created Equation :
</em>
\frac{400 x 60}{100}

Now we'll solve it step by step to find the answer.

So we should begin by multiplying the to portion of our fraction.

<em>400 x 60 = 24,000</em>

Next, we divide our answer by 100, since that is the next step to our equation.

<em>24,000 ÷ 100 = 240</em>

So, our answer is...

<em>Paul has already saved</em>  $240.00  <em>of the $400.00 he must pay for a new bike.</em>
